Output 66f3e4e8de43374261104b19c7f6ca2a1e29da49ba0bcef294a52c0d6e9813ec:20

value
41991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6b362be5172dd431b5934a239abbea6d900a84 OP_EQUAL
address
3N4M3WpjDiqEsgix6KPdFcsaAsQKkoyyjf
transaction
66f3e4e8de43374261104b19c7f6ca2a1e29da49ba0bcef294a52c0d6e9813ec
spent
true